Precision CNC Machining: From Design to Prototype
The journey from a imagination on paper to a tangible prototype is where precision CNC machining shines. It leverages advanced computer-aided design (CAD) software to translate your vision into detailed machine instructions. These instructions then guide the CNC machine, which meticulously removes material from a workpiece, creating complex and intricate shapes with unparalleled accuracy.
This versatility makes CNC machining ideal for a broad spectrum of industries, from aerospace and medical check here to automotive and consumer goods. Whether you need single prototypes or small batch production runs, CNC machining offers a reliable solution that meets the rigorous requirements of modern design.

CNC Milling & Turning for High-Quality Prototypes
Rapid prototyping needs precision and efficiency to create innovative ideas to life. CNC milling and turning are essential processes that provide unparalleled accuracy and control, guaranteeing high-quality prototypes for a diverse range of applications.
- CNC milling utilizes rotating cutters to remove material from a solid workpiece, creating complex geometries with intricate details.
- Turning features a rotating workpiece and a stationary cutting tool to manufacture cylindrical shapes, appropriate for shafts, rods, and other components.
The combination of these technologies allows for the production of prototypes with exceptional surface finishes, tight tolerances, and complex features.
